#38d174 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#38d174 is composed of 22% red, 82% green and 45.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 44.5%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 143.5 degrees, a saturation of 62.4% and a lightness of 52%. #38d174 color hex could be obtained by blending #70ffe8 with #00a300.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

#38d174 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#38d174 has RGB values of R:56, G:209, B:116 and CMYK values of C:0.73, M:0, Y:0.44,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 3723636.

Shades and Tints of #38d174
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020804 is the darkest color, while #f7fdfa is the lightest one.
